The BU-67432F030L SPACE-PHY is a completely integrated MIL-STD-1553 physical layer in a single package. The SPACE-PHY includes dual transceiver and transformers, suitable for connection to IP instantiated in an FPGA or custom MIL-STD-1553 protocol ASICs.
Benefits
- Small Size Saves Space
- Replaces Two Transceivers and Two Transformers
- Single Package Simplifies Layout
- Improved Reliability (MTBF) with Single Package
Applications
- Launch Vehicles
- Military Satellites
- Research Satellites
- The International Space Station
- The Commercial Telecommunication Satellite
Features
- Dual-Redundant, Side-by-Side, MIL-STD-1553 Transceiver/Transformer Combo
- Flatpack Package
- Max size: 1 in. x 1 in. x 0.25 in. (25.4 mm x 25.4 mm x 6.35 mm)
- Case Temperature Range: -55°C to +125°C
- Radiation Specifications:
- SEU Threshold: 80 MeV-cm²/mg
- Total Dose: 100 krads
- Dual Tap Secondaries
- Sencondaries' Center Taps Brought Out
- DSCC MIL-PRF-38534 Class H or K Certified
